Just How Roofing Air Flow Works
Efficient roofing system air flow counts on the natural motion of air to produce an equilibrium between consumption and exhaust. When best roofing company in san antonio install vents, you're basically allowing fresh air to enter your attic while enabling warm, stale air to get away. This process aids control temperature and dampness degrees, avoiding issues like mold and mildew growth and roofing damages.
roofing contracting , commonly found at the eaves, reel in cool air from outside. Meanwhile, exhaust vents, located near the ridge of the roofing, let hot air rise and departure. The distinction in temperature level creates an all-natural airflow, known as the stack impact. As cozy air rises, it develops a vacuum that draws in cooler air from the reduced vents.
To enhance this system, you need to make sure that the intake and exhaust vents are effectively sized and positioned. If the intake is restricted, you won't achieve the desired air flow.
Similarly, not enough exhaust can trap warmth and wetness, causing potential damages.
Trick Setup Considerations
When mounting roofing ventilation, several crucial considerations can make or break your system's efficiency. Initially, you need to evaluate your roof's style. The pitch, form, and products all influence airflow and ventilation choice. Make certain to pick vents that fit your roofing type and neighborhood environment problems.
Next, take into consideration the placement of your vents. Preferably, you'll desire a balanced system with intake and exhaust vents placed for optimal air flow. Place consumption vents low on the roofing system and exhaust vents near the top to motivate an all-natural circulation of air. This arrangement helps avoid dampness buildup and promotes energy efficiency.
Don't ignore insulation. Correct insulation in your attic stops warmth from escaping and keeps your home comfortable. Guarantee that insulation does not obstruct your vents, as this can hinder air flow.
Lastly, think about maintenance. Pick air flow systems that are easy to accessibility for cleaning and inspection. Normal upkeep guarantees your system continues to operate efficiently gradually.
